How I Built It

Metatron is built with a modern TypeScript stack using Vite + React, with Gemini 3 Flash acting as the core reasoning engine.

Core Logic & Visualization

  • Zod for schema validation, converted into JSON Schemas for Gemini’s structured output mode
  • Molecular data from PubChem
  • RDKit for 2D molecular rendering
  • NGL for interactive 3D molecular visualization
  • Three.js for the virtual lab environment and reaction effects

Agent Architecture

The autonomous research agent uses Gemini’s function calling to manage a multi‑phase workflow:

Planning → Execution → Verification → Emissions Assessment → Reporting

This allows the AI to reason across steps, maintain state, and produce structured scientific output.

Voice NLP

The VoiceCommandManager leverages Gemini to interpret spoken commands and map them directly to application functions, enabling smooth voice‑driven interaction.

Challenges Along the Way

Building Metatron wasn’t easy.

  • As a master’s student, I had to balance exams and multiple academic projects, leaving limited development time and forcing me to work completely solo.
  • A steep learning curve with 3D rendering: first time using NGL and Three.js. I originally planned a full VR lab experience, but time constraints limited the first version to a web‑based simulation.
  • Voice control introduced another challenge: the SpeechRecognition Web API behaves inconsistently across browsers, making testing and debugging difficult.
